  • TS1441 My ipod was recently disabled and now says "connect to iTunes" although my ipod has never been synced to my Mac laptop it will not allow me to. I need help.

    My ipod was recently disabled and now says "connect to iTunes" although my ipod has never been synced to my Mac laptop it will not allow me to. I need help.

    Place the iOS device in Recovery Mode and then connect to your computer and restore via iTunes. The iPod will be erased.
    iOS: Wrong passcode results in red disabled screen                          
    If recovery mode does not work try DFU mode.                         
    How to put iPod touch / iPhone into DFU mode « Karthik's scribblings         
    For how to restore:
    iTunes: Restoring iOS software
    To restore from backup (if you have an iCloud backup) see:
    iOS: How to back up
    If you restore from iCloud backup the apps will be automatically downloaded. If you restore from iTunes backup the apps and music have to be in the iTunes library since synced media like apps and music are not included in the backup of the iOS device that iTunes makes.
